Can I arrive after the start date on the DS-2019?

Plan your trip according to the DS-2019 start date to avoid issues with the J visa; delays may require contacting your sponsor and reviewing exceptions.

The DS-2019 is an essential document for the J visa, as it indicates the period during which you must begin and complete your exchange program. It includes a start date that must be carefully observed, both to avoid complications when entering the United States and to comply with the rules established by the exchange program.

Normally, J visa participants must enter the country within a specific window relative to the start date indicated on the DS-2019-usually up to 30 days before the program begins. Arriving after this date may be considered a violation of the conditions of your exchange visitor status, which in many cases prevents the regular start of the activities planned in the program.

If there is an exceptional or unforeseen situation, it is best to contact your program sponsor immediately to check the possibility of updating the start date on the DS-2019. However, it is important to emphasize that these changes are not automatic and depend on the review and approval of the organization responsible for your exchange.

I always highlight the importance of strictly following U.S. immigration laws and the need to seek information directly from reliable sources or qualified specialists. Be wary of offers and information promising miraculous solutions, as they can be misleading.

After all, respecting deadlines and established rules is fundamental to the success of your exchange and to maintaining your legal status in the country.

In summary, it is advisable to plan your trip according to the start date on the DS-2019. If you encounter difficulties arriving by that date, consult your sponsor and, if necessary, seek specialized guidance to assess which measures can be taken, always in compliance with U.S. immigration laws.
